Hi Arka,

I saw this thread by luck and you broght back the nostalgic memories which go back to 25 years. Even then we had very few 1tons and they were getting replaced by TATA 403. What ever was left were getting modified as "Commanding officers" caravan or used as school bus. I have driven this beast and is a superb vehucle and very comfortable - the same reason for being choice for caravans, school buses and ambulance! The engine is smooth and powerful. 1 ton also had another role - recovery vehicle. It was being used for pulling vehicles stuck in sand or slush. My all time favoutie fauji vehicle is Jonga. It was the mean machine

Hi Guys,

The Nissan 4W73 was driven by UBS on Day#2 of TPC2011, and the PTO winch was put to good use at SS2.

While driving out of riverbed at the end of Day#2 the 1 Ton got stuck in a sand pit, and we realized the the winch cable and Guides were jumbled, a few of us stripped and rewound the cable and the 1Ton Winched herself out.

Many thanks to UBS for the new carb and Mhd Ali for changing the same on the eve of TPC2011.
